如何在docker中运行MySQL实例 🐳🚀

导读 在现代软件开发和部署过程中,使用容器化技术如Docker可以极大简化应用环境配置。MySQL数据库作为最流行的开源关系型数据库之一,其在Docke

在现代软件开发和部署过程中,使用容器化技术如Docker可以极大简化应用环境配置。MySQL数据库作为最流行的开源关系型数据库之一,其在Docker中的运行也变得十分便捷。本文将一步步指导你如何在Docker中运行一个MySQL实例,以及如何运行已创建的MySQL数据库。

首先,确保你的机器上已经安装了Docker。可以通过命令 `docker --version` 来检查是否已安装。如果未安装,请访问Docker官网下载并安装适合你操作系统的版本。

接下来,我们可以使用官方的MySQL镜像来启动一个新的MySQL实例。打开终端或命令行工具,输入以下命令:

```

docker run --name some-mysql -e MYSQL_ROOT_PASSWORD=my-secret-pw -d mysql:tag

```

这里,`some-mysql` 是容器的名字,`my-secret-pw` 是root用户的密码,`mysql:tag` 表示使用的MySQL镜像版本,你可以根据需要替换为具体的版本号,比如 `mysql:5.7`。

如果你已经有数据想要导入到新的MySQL实例中,可以使用 `-v` 参数将本地的数据目录挂载到容器内。例如:

```

docker run --name some-mysql -v /host/path/to/data:/var/lib/mysql -e MYSQL_ROOT_PASSWORD=my-secret-pw -d mysql:tag

```

这样,你就可以轻松地在Docker环境中运行MySQL实例,并管理你的数据库了。🚀

郑重声明:本文版权归原作者所有,转载文章仅为传播更多信息之目的,如作者信息标记有误,请第一时候联系我们修改或删除,多谢。